Utilisation d'un TFT 4.0" + déport logement carte SD possible ?
Posté : 28 nov. 2020 23:16
Bonjour,
Comme indiqué dans le topic, deux sujets...
1 - Je m'interroge donc sur la faisabilité de remplacer l'écran tactile de 2.8" par un écran tactile de 4.0".
J'ai commandé celui-ci en 4.0", donc. Alors ? Marchera ou marchera pas ?
D'après l'annonce, l'affectation des pins est identique sur tous les écrans tactiles vendus dans cette annonce, exception faite de celui en 2.2", non équipé de la fonction tactile. Cette affectation des pins est identique à celle des pins de l'écran tactile de 2.8" qui équipe actuellement la RS-CNC32. Donc pour la partie câblage tout du moins, le 4.0" semble parfaitement compatible.
Le driver de l'écran tactile de 4.0" n'est, en revanche, pas le même que sur l'écran tactile de 2.8" que l'on utilise actuellement sur la RS-CNC32. Pour le 4.0" le divers est le ST7796S.
J'ai jeté un œil au firmware de l'ESP-32, mais évidemment, je n'y comprends pas grand chose. J'ai quand même relevé que le répertoire "TFT_eSPI_ms" contenait un sous-répertoire "TFT_Drivers", dans lequel je n'ai pas trouvé le driver du ST7796S. Je suppose qu'il doit également falloir bidouiller quelques trucs dans le firmware de l'ESP-32 pour faire à minima prendre en compte la résolution d'affichage plus importante pour l'écran tactile de 4.0", que pour celui de 2.8".
2 - Déporter le logement de la carte SD.
Je souhaiterai juste savoir si j'ai bon en pensant que pour déporter le logement de la carte SD, je ne suis pas obligé de le raccorder aux pins SD_CS, SD_MOSI, SD_MISO, SD_SCK de l'écran tactile et que je peux raccorder directement ce module, par exemple, à la carte GRBL adapteur, dès lors que je connecte respectivement ses pins CS, MOSI, MISO, SCK aux pins correspondantes sur la carte GRBL adaptateur. En regardant le dessin des pistes à l'arrière du circuit imprimé de l'écran, on a l'impression que seules ces pins du logement de la carte SD sont raccordés. En revanche, il faut peut-être quand même alimenter le module dont j'ai donné le lien en 3.3V, non ?
@+
Comme indiqué dans le topic, deux sujets...
1 - Je m'interroge donc sur la faisabilité de remplacer l'écran tactile de 2.8" par un écran tactile de 4.0".
J'ai commandé celui-ci en 4.0", donc. Alors ? Marchera ou marchera pas ?
D'après l'annonce, l'affectation des pins est identique sur tous les écrans tactiles vendus dans cette annonce, exception faite de celui en 2.2", non équipé de la fonction tactile. Cette affectation des pins est identique à celle des pins de l'écran tactile de 2.8" qui équipe actuellement la RS-CNC32. Donc pour la partie câblage tout du moins, le 4.0" semble parfaitement compatible.
Le driver de l'écran tactile de 4.0" n'est, en revanche, pas le même que sur l'écran tactile de 2.8" que l'on utilise actuellement sur la RS-CNC32. Pour le 4.0" le divers est le ST7796S.
J'ai jeté un œil au firmware de l'ESP-32, mais évidemment, je n'y comprends pas grand chose. J'ai quand même relevé que le répertoire "TFT_eSPI_ms" contenait un sous-répertoire "TFT_Drivers", dans lequel je n'ai pas trouvé le driver du ST7796S. Je suppose qu'il doit également falloir bidouiller quelques trucs dans le firmware de l'ESP-32 pour faire à minima prendre en compte la résolution d'affichage plus importante pour l'écran tactile de 4.0", que pour celui de 2.8".
2 - Déporter le logement de la carte SD.
Je souhaiterai juste savoir si j'ai bon en pensant que pour déporter le logement de la carte SD, je ne suis pas obligé de le raccorder aux pins SD_CS, SD_MOSI, SD_MISO, SD_SCK de l'écran tactile et que je peux raccorder directement ce module, par exemple, à la carte GRBL adapteur, dès lors que je connecte respectivement ses pins CS, MOSI, MISO, SCK aux pins correspondantes sur la carte GRBL adaptateur. En regardant le dessin des pistes à l'arrière du circuit imprimé de l'écran, on a l'impression que seules ces pins du logement de la carte SD sont raccordés. En revanche, il faut peut-être quand même alimenter le module dont j'ai donné le lien en 3.3V, non ?
@+